Introduction to Unit Testing in Go
Go, also known as Golang, takes a minimalist approach to testing, which can be both a blessing and a curse. Unlike other languages, Go doesn't have built-in assertions or annotations, leaving it up to developers to create their own testing frameworks. While this may seem daunting at first, it actually provides an opportunity to develop a deeper understanding of testing principles and how to apply them effectively in your code.
The Go standard library includes a testing package that provides basic support for automated testing. This package allows you to write and run tests using the go test command. However, to get the most out of unit testing in Go, you'll need to learn how to structure your tests, use testing libraries, and integrate testing into your development workflow.
Why Unit Testing Matters
Unit testing is a critical component of software development that offers numerous benefits, including:
- Improved Code Quality: By writing tests for individual components, you ensure that each part of your codebase functions correctly, leading to higher overall quality.
- Faster Debugging: When issues arise, a robust set of unit tests can help you quickly identify the source of the problem, reducing debugging time and effort.
- Reduced Fear of Change: With a comprehensive suite of unit tests, you can refactor your code with confidence, knowing that any changes won't break existing functionality.
Practical Applications and Examples
To illustrate the concepts of unit testing in Go, let's consider a simple example. Suppose we have a function that calculates the sum of two integers:
func Add(x, y int) int {
return x + y
}
We can write a test for this function using the testing package:
func TestAdd(t *testing.T) {
if Add(1, 2) != 3 {
t.Errorf("Add(1, 2) = %d, want 3", Add(1, 2))
}
}
This test checks if the Add function returns the expected result for a given input. By running this test, we can verify that our function behaves as intended.
